Plunket holds golf day
A golf day with a dif- ^ ference is to be held this Saturday at the Waimarino Golf Club. The Plunket organised tournament is an opportunity for golfers and non-golfers alike to participate. Activities begin at midday, with the start
of an 18-hold round of golf and a huge list of prizes up for grabs. Prizes will be awarded in a number of categories, including mens' longest drive and ladies' golf ball nearest the pin. The tournament will culminate in an afternoon tea provided by Plunket members.
